A refined and eye-catching hellebore, ‘Father of the Bride’ features creamy white flowers dramatically speckled and flushed with deep burgundy near the center. Blooming in late winter to early spring, the long-lasting, outward-facing flowers rise above glossy, evergreen foliage, bringing welcome color and elegance to shaded gardens when little else is in bloom.
